Description

3,5-Difluoro-4-formylbenzonitrile is a high-value, multi-functional aromatic building block characterized by its difluoro-substituted benzaldehyde core and a reactive nitrile group. This compound matters for its unique electronic and steric properties, making it an essential intermediate in the synthesis of complex molecules, particularly in advanced pharmaceutical and agrochemical research. It is primarily needed by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and material science industries for constructing novel active ingredients and functional materials.

Application

  • Pharmaceutical Intermediate: A key synthon for the development of active pharmaceutical ingredients (APIs), especially in kinase inhibitors and other small-molecule therapeutics.
  • Agrochemical Synthesis: Used in the research and production of advanced herbicides, fungicides, and pesticides, leveraging the fluorine atoms for enhanced bioactivity and metabolic stability.
  • Liquid Crystal & OLED Materials: Serves as a precursor for constructing polar components in liquid crystal displays (LCDs) and organic light-emitting diodes (OLEDs) due to its rigid, polarizable structure.
  • Polymer & Resin Modifier: Incorporated into specialty polymers to impart specific chemical resistance, thermal stability, or optical properties.
  • Cross-Coupling Reactions: The formyl and nitrile groups make it a versatile substrate for Suzuki, Sonogashira, and other palladium-catalyzed cross-coupling reactions.
  • Ligand & Catalyst Development: Utilized in the synthesis of novel chelating ligands and organocatalysts for asymmetric synthesis.

Basic Information

Product Name 3,5-Difluoro-4-formylbenzonitrile
CAS No. 467442-15-5
Molecular Formula C8H3F2NO
Molecular Weight 167.11 g/mol
Synonyms 4-Cyano-2,6-difluorobenzaldehyde; 2,6-Difluoro-4-formylbenzonitrile; 2,6-Difluoro-4-cyanobenzaldehyde; 4-Formyl-3,5-difluorobenzonitrile; Benzonitrile, 3,5-difluoro-4-formyl-; 3,5-Difluorobenzaldehyde-4-carbonitrile

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from heat, sparks, and open flame. The compound is light-sensitive and should be handled under appropriate conditions to prevent degradation.
